How to Play an Online Lottery

The first state to sell lottery tickets online was Illinois, which reported that sales were up over 40% in its first week. In order to play, customers must be a resident or live within the state boundaries. So, a Colorado resident can’t play an instant win game in Georgia or a subscription to the Virginia lottery. Online lottery sites offer a variety of payment methods, including prepaid plans. Many of them also allow you to set recurring payments, which can help you manage your finances and avoid losing your tickets. Some sites even allow you to set a schedule so that you can buy tickets on a regular basis. These online services will then automatically purchase your tickets for you on your own schedule, allowing you to focus on other aspects of your life. While online lottery sites are convenient, they are not government-run. They are run by private companies, which are middlemen between you and the lotteries.
